Press and hold Side button until the screen goes black. Press and hold the Side button and Volume Down button at the same time for 5 seconds. Release Side button while continuing to hold the Volume Down button. When the screen turns black completely, your iPhone 8 (Plus) is in DFU mode.

Quickly press the volume up button on the side of your iPhone. Quickly press the volume down button on the side of your iPhone. Press and hold the power button. Release the power button when the Apple logo appears on the display. Your iPhone 8 will turn back on shortly after. View More.
Access the Settings on Your iPhone to Turn Off Zoom: You should be able to navigate your zoomed-in iPhone by dragging with three fingers. If you can do that, make your way to the Settings app. On iOS 13 and later: Go to Settings > Accessibility > Zoom. On iOS 12 or earlier: Go to Settings > General > Accessibility > Zoom.
The iPhone 8 Plus’ display isn’t any different from the iPhone 7 Plus. It’s a 5.5-inch LCD IPS screen with a 1,920 × 1,080-pixel resolution (401 pixels-per-inch).
If you are using an iPhone X, pull down your Control Center with a swipe from the top right corner of the screen. Hard-press (3D Touch) on the brightness slider, and it will expand to a full-screen mode. Here, you can find the toggles for Night Shift as well as for True Tone. Tap on the True Tone toggle to disable or enable the feature.
